I noticed CK3 is using a very large amount of memory (more than 10 GB according to the Ressource Monitor) with just launching the game.

This lead to systematic crash when using mods and instability in vanilla (depending on other RAMusage).

Increasing RAM via the paging size solves the problem however such a high ram usage doesn't seems normal.
 
Is that only when using mods? What do you see when all of them are disabled?

In the main game menu ck3.exe uses 2.4gb on my modest rig. At the start of a new game, 3.6gb.
 
I reach 10 GB committed (so virtual memory) without any mod in the main menu and just a bit more when starting a new game.
Physical memory seems not too high however.

1651576124264.png
 
I was only looking at physical memory. To get that many page faults I'd think you might be short of memory overall, perhaps running a lot of other stuff at the same time?

If you exit all other apps before starting the game does that still happen? What size page file do you have? I recommend at least 16gb these days, in some cases up to 64gb.

BTW where is that dialog? It's not one I'm familiar with.
 
I'm not usually running much: steam, firefox, discord. I have 16GB RAM.

I was using 12GB for paging size and switched to automatic. Windows currently set it to 26 GB.

This dialog is from process explorer.
 
Okay, I recommend at least a 32gb maximum these days, in some cases up to 64gb!
